Bible Verses About Rivers: (Drying up of,) of God's judgments
Verses on (Drying up of,) of God's judgments
This is a prophecy about Egypt: Look! ADONAI is riding a swift cloud, on his way to Egypt. Before him Egypt's idols tremble, Egypt's courage melts within them.
"I will incite Egypt against Egypt, brother will fight against brother, friend against friend, city against city, kingdom against kingdom.
The courage of Egypt will ebb away within it, I will reduce its counsel to confusion. They will consult idols and mediums, ghosts and spirits.
I will hand over the Egyptians to a cruel master. A harsh king will rule them," says the Lord, ADONAI-Tzva'ot.
The water will ebb from the sea, the river will be drained dry.
The rivers will become foul, the canals of Egypt's Nile will dwindle and dry up, the reeds and rushes will wither.
The river-plants on the banks of the Nile and everything sown near the Nile will dry up, blow away and be no more.
Fishermen too will lament, all who cast hooks in the Nile will mourn, those who spread nets on the water lose heart.
Therefore here is what ADONAI says: "I will plead your cause. I will take vengeance for you. I will dry up her river and make her water sources dry.
He rebukes the sea and leaves it dry, he dries up all the rivers. Bashan and the Karmel languish; the flower of the L'vanon withers.
"Trouble will pass over the sea and stir up waves in the sea; all the depths of the Nile will be dried up, the pride of Ashur will be brought down, and the scepter of Egypt will leave.
